Minificador de JS



Ingrese su código JS para comprimir:



Agregue hasta 10 archivos JS múltiples (Límite de tamaño: 2 MB por archivo)





Acerca de Minificador de JS

Un minificador JS reduce el tamaño de archivos JavaScript eliminando caracteres innecesarios sin alterar la funcionalidad del código. El minificador JavaScript de ToolsPivot comprime tus scripts eliminando espacios en blanco, comentarios y sintaxis redundante, logrando reducciones de hasta el 80% en el tamaño del archivo. Desarrolladores web, ingenieros front-end y propietarios de sitios utilizan esta herramienta para acelerar tiempos de carga y mejorar puntuaciones de Core Web Vitals.

Descripción del Minificador JS de ToolsPivot

Funcionalidad Principal

El minificador JS de ToolsPivot procesa código JavaScript mediante análisis léxico, eliminando espacios, saltos de línea y comentarios mientras acorta nombres de variables. La herramienta analiza tu script en un Árbol de Sintaxis Abstracta (AST), aplica transformaciones de optimización y genera código comprimido que se ejecuta de forma idéntica al original. Ingresa tu JavaScript sin procesar y recibe código minificado listo para producción en segundos.

Usuarios Principales y Casos de Uso

Los desarrolladores front-end que preparan código para despliegue utilizan esta herramienta con mayor frecuencia. Tiendas online comprimen scripts de páginas de producto, plataformas SaaS optimizan funcionalidades de dashboard, y agencias entregan sitios web más livianos a sus clientes. Equipos de marketing que minifican archivos CSS junto con scripts de seguimiento también se benefician de la compresión rápida de JavaScript.

Problema y Solución

Los archivos JavaScript sin minificar aumentan el peso de la página y ralentizan las velocidades de descarga, perjudicando la experiencia del usuario y el posicionamiento en buscadores. Antes de la minificación, un archivo de script de 100KB consume ancho de banda y retrasa la interactividad. Después de procesarlo con el minificador de ToolsPivot, ese mismo archivo se reduce a 20-40KB, cargando 2-3 veces más rápido y mejorando significativamente tus puntuaciones de velocidad de página.

Beneficios Clave del Minificador JS

  • Tiempos de Carga Más Rápidos: Los scripts comprimidos se descargan más rápido, reduciendo el Time to Interactive en un 40-60% en promedio.

  • Mejor Rendimiento SEO: Google utiliza la velocidad de página como factor de posicionamiento, y el JavaScript minificado contribuye directamente a mejores puntuaciones de Core Web Vitals.

  • Costos de Ancho de Banda Reducidos: Archivos más pequeños significan menores gastos de transferencia de datos para sitios web de alto tráfico que sirven millones de solicitudes mensuales.

  • Mejor Experiencia Móvil: Los usuarios en conexiones 3G/4G se benefician más de scripts comprimidos que cargan eficientemente con ancho de banda limitado.

  • Mayor Eficiencia del Servidor: Los tamaños de archivo reducidos disminuyen la carga del servidor y permiten más conexiones simultáneas, similar a cuando comprimes código HTML.

  • Salida Lista para Producción: El código minificado funciona inmediatamente en entornos de producción sin procesamiento adicional.

  • Funcionalidad Mantenida: Todas las operaciones JavaScript se ejecutan de forma idéntica después de la minificación sin cambios de comportamiento.

Características Principales del Minificador JS

  • Eliminación de Espacios en Blanco: Elimina todos los espacios, tabulaciones y saltos de línea innecesarios que no añaden valor funcional a la ejecución.

  • Eliminación de Comentarios: Remueve comentarios de una línea y multilínea que aumentan el tamaño del archivo sin afectar el comportamiento en tiempo de ejecución.

  • Acortamiento de Variables: Renombra variables locales y parámetros de función a identificadores de un solo carácter cuando es seguro hacerlo.

  • Eliminación de Código Muerto: Identifica y elimina rutas de código inalcanzables que nunca se ejecutan durante el tiempo de ejecución.

  • Soporte Sintaxis ES6+: Maneja características modernas de JavaScript incluyendo funciones flecha, literales de plantilla, async/await y desestructuración.

  • Procesamiento Instantáneo: Comprime código en segundos sin requerir registro de cuenta ni subida de archivos a servidores externos.

  • Interfaz Copiar-Pegar: Campo de entrada simple que acepta código JavaScript sin procesar para minificación inmediata.

  • Transformaciones Seguras: Aplica solo optimizaciones que no rompen el código y preservan el comportamiento en todos los navegadores.

  • Procesamiento por Lotes: Pega múltiples contenidos de scripts para comprimir archivos de proyecto completos en una sola sesión.

  • Vista Previa de Salida: Visualiza resultados minificados inmediatamente y compara versiones de código antes de desplegar.

Cómo Funciona el Minificador JS de ToolsPivot

  1. Pega Tu Código: Copia tu código fuente JavaScript en el área de texto de entrada.

  2. Haz Clic en Minificar: Presiona el botón minificar para iniciar el proceso de compresión.

  3. Procesamiento Completo: La herramienta analiza, optimiza y transforma tu código en segundos.

  4. Revisa la Salida: Examina el JavaScript comprimido en el campo de salida.

  5. Copia los Resultados: Haz clic en copiar al portapapeles y pega el código minificado en los archivos de tu proyecto.

  6. Despliega a Producción: Usa el script comprimido directamente en tu sitio web o aplicación.

Cuándo Usar el Minificador JS

La minificación de JavaScript ofrece máximo valor durante las fases de despliegue a producción y optimización de rendimiento. Usa esta herramienta cuando prepares código para entornos en vivo donde el tamaño del archivo impacta directamente la experiencia del usuario y el SEO.

Escenarios de Uso Específicos:

  • Despliegue a Producción: Minifica todos los archivos JavaScript antes de enviar código a servidores en vivo.

  • Auditorías de Rendimiento: Comprime scripts cuando audites tu sitio web para mejoras de velocidad.

  • Optimización de Scripts de Terceros: Reduce el tamaño de scripts inline y código de seguimiento personalizado.

  • Webviews de Apps Móviles: Comprime JavaScript para aplicaciones híbridas que sirven contenido web.

  • Preparación para CDN: Minimiza archivos antes de subirlos a redes de distribución de contenido.

  • Integración en Pipeline de Build: Genera salida minificada para flujos de trabajo de despliegue automatizado.

  • Actualizaciones de Código Legado: Comprime scripts antiguos durante proyectos de modernización.

  • Scripts de Testing A/B: Reduce tamaños de archivo de frameworks de testing para minimizar impacto en velocidad de página.

Omite la minificación durante el desarrollo activo cuando necesites código legible para depuración.

Casos de Uso / Aplicaciones

Páginas de Producto E-Commerce

Contexto: Tiendas online con cientos de páginas de producto ejecutando características interactivas y carruseles.

Proceso:

  • Minificar JavaScript de galería de productos reduciendo tamaño de archivo en 70%
  • Comprimir scripts de validación de checkout para carga más rápida del carrito
  • Optimizar código de funcionalidad de filtrado y ordenamiento

Resultado: Las páginas de producto cargan 2 segundos más rápido, reduciendo tasas de rebote y aumentando conversiones.

Aplicaciones Dashboard SaaS

Contexto: Aplicaciones web con JavaScript complejo manejando interacciones de usuario y visualización de datos.

Proceso:

  • Comprimir código de widgets de dashboard de 500KB a 150KB
  • Minificar implementaciones de librerías de gráficos
  • Reducir tamaños de scripts de interacción con API

Resultado: El tiempo de carga inicial del dashboard baja de 4 segundos a 1.5 segundos, mejorando la retención de usuarios.

Landing Pages de Marketing

Contexto: Páginas de campaña que requieren tiempos de carga rápidos para maximizar tasas de conversión.

Proceso:

  • Minificar scripts de validación de formularios y seguimiento
  • Comprimir código de animación e interacción
  • Optimizar JavaScript de implementación de analytics
  • Analizar tiempos de carga antes y después de optimización

Resultado: La landing page logra tiempo de carga inferior a 2 segundos, aumentando captura de leads en 25%.

Optimización de Temas WordPress

Contexto: Temas WordPress personalizados con múltiples archivos JavaScript afectando el rendimiento del sitio.

Proceso:

  • Comprimir archivos JavaScript del tema individualmente
  • Minificar scripts de interacción de plugins
  • Validar mejoras con herramientas de velocidad

Resultado: La huella JavaScript del tema se reduce en 60%, mejorando puntuaciones de velocidad del sitio WordPress.

Diferencia entre Minificación y Compresión GZIP

La optimización de JavaScript involucra técnicas distintas que los desarrolladores frecuentemente confunden. La minificación elimina caracteres innecesarios como espacios en blanco y comentarios sin cambiar la estructura del código. La compresión GZIP aplica algoritmos de codificación para reducir el tamaño del archivo durante la transferencia HTTP.

Diferencias Clave:

  • Minificación: Remueve formato legible por humanos, reduce tamaño de archivo en 40-80%, se aplica al código fuente
  • Compresión GZIP: Usa codificación a nivel de servidor, reduce tamaño de transferencia en 60-80% adicional, se aplica durante transmisión HTTP

Para máximo rendimiento, usa minificación primero en tu código, luego verifica el estado GZIP en tu servidor. Ambas técnicas trabajan en conjunto para lograr máxima optimización de transferencia.

Herramientas de Minificación Populares

Los desarrolladores disponen de varias opciones para minificar JavaScript según sus necesidades y entorno de trabajo.

Motores de Minificación Principales:

  • Terser: Estándar actual de la industria para código ES6+, usado por webpack, Angular y Next.js con más de 18 millones de descargas semanales
  • UglifyJS: Minificador ES5 con compresión agresiva, aún utilizado para bases de código legacy que requieren máxima compatibilidad
  • Google Closure Compiler: Optimizador avanzado que reescribe estructura de código, ideal para aplicaciones que requieren optimización profunda

Las herramientas online como ToolsPivot ofrecen conveniencia para tareas rápidas sin necesidad de configurar entornos de desarrollo locales.

Herramientas Relacionadas

Completa tu flujo de trabajo con estas herramientas complementarias de ToolsPivot:

Preguntas Frecuentes

¿Qué es la minificación de JavaScript?

La minificación de JavaScript elimina caracteres innecesarios del código fuente incluyendo espacios en blanco, comentarios y saltos de línea sin cambiar la funcionalidad. El proceso reduce el tamaño del archivo en 40-80%, acelerando tiempos de carga de página.

¿La minificación rompe el código JavaScript?

No, el JavaScript correctamente minificado se ejecuta de forma idéntica al código fuente original. El minificador de ToolsPivot aplica solo transformaciones seguras que preservan todo el comportamiento del código en todos los navegadores.

¿Cuánta reducción de tamaño logra la minificación JS?

La minificación típica reduce tamaños de archivo JavaScript en 40-80% dependiendo del formato del código original. Código bien comentado con espacios extensivos ve mayores reducciones que scripts ya compactos.

¿El JavaScript minificado es reversible?

La minificación es un proceso de una sola vía que elimina información permanentemente. Mantén copias de respaldo de archivos fuente originales para edición futura. Los source maps pueden vincular código minificado de vuelta a fuentes originales para depuración.

¿Debo minificar JavaScript para sitios pequeños?

Sí, incluso sitios web pequeños se benefician de la minificación. Cada kilobyte ahorrado mejora tiempos de carga móvil y contribuye a mejores rankings de búsqueda a través de velocidades de página más rápidas.

¿Cuál es la diferencia entre minificación y compresión GZIP?

La minificación elimina caracteres innecesarios del código mismo. La compresión GZIP codifica el archivo resultante para transferencia de red más pequeña. Usa ambas juntas para máxima optimización.

¿El minificador de ToolsPivot soporta JavaScript ES6+?

Sí, el minificador maneja toda la sintaxis moderna de JavaScript incluyendo funciones flecha, async/await, desestructuración, literales de plantilla y módulos ES sin problemas de compatibilidad.

¿La minificación puede mejorar rankings SEO?

Sí, tiempos de carga de página más rápidos por JavaScript minificado contribuyen directamente a mejores puntuaciones de Core Web Vitals. Google usa velocidad de página como señal de ranking para resultados de búsqueda tanto de escritorio como móvil.

¿Es seguro minificar JavaScript de terceros?

Sí, minificar scripts de terceros es seguro cuando el código original funciona correctamente. Prueba la salida minificada en desarrollo antes de desplegar a entornos de producción.

¿Debo minificar JavaScript durante el desarrollo?

No, mantén JavaScript sin minificar durante el desarrollo para depuración más fácil. Minifica solo cuando prepares código para despliegue a producción donde la legibilidad no es requerida.

¿Cómo afecta la minificación la depuración de JavaScript?

El código minificado es más difícil de depurar debido a nombres de variables acortados y formato eliminado. Usa source maps en desarrollo para vincular salida minificada de vuelta a archivos fuente originales.

¿Puedo minificar múltiples archivos JavaScript a la vez?

Sí, pega múltiples contenidos de scripts en el campo de entrada para comprimirlos secuencialmente. Para procesamiento por lotes automatizado, integra minificación en tu pipeline de build usando paquetes npm.



Report a Bug
Logo

CONTACT US

marketing@toolspivot.com

ADDRESS

Ward No.1, Nehuta, P.O - Kusha, P.S - Dobhi, Gaya, Bihar, India, 824220

Our Most Popular Tools